The best thing you could have done is to leave the rockwool on and that would have anchored it as the HC grew.
I presume you didn't do that?? If not, then you're going to have to push it deep into the substrate and just leave a few leaves open and let it grow from there.
Yup always a tough plant to root unless you have something clay based which compresses and doesn't really move. If Ian's suggestion doesn't work try adding more gravel to the carpeting area.
Judging by your first picture above looks to me that you have a Cory or more in there. That may well be why you are getting clumps floating
Very hard to get something like glosso or HC to stay with Corys in there unless they are added after it has gotten up and running as they snuffle all over the place and knock it loose
